Offered by SOAS University of London, the BA (Hons) Law and Social Anthropology provides a comprehensive undergraduate education in social sciences. Based in London, England, this programme combines theoretical knowledge with practical application, with a 3-year full-time structure. The SOAS Law combined honours degree produces highly skilled, civic minded and critically engaged graduates, who can effectively contribute to their communities and societies through the knowledge and skills gained on this course. In an increasingly interconnected world, law is no longer the preserve of single jurisdictions as legal issues are no respecters of national borders. A SOAS Law degree addresses this need by providing our students with an educational experience that equips you with a distinctive set of skills far beyond what is offered by most traditional Law Schools. International tuition fees are £23,780 per year, home/UK fees are £9,790 per year, and a minimum IELTS score of 6.0 is required for admission. Graduates from this programme benefit from strong career prospects, with 94% student satisfaction rating, a median graduate salary of £26,500 within three years, and a 90% continuation rate.

Based on official HESA Graduate Outcomes survey data
| Time After Graduation | Lower Quartile Salary | Median Salary | Upper Quartile Salary |
|---|---|---|---|
| 15 months | £23,000 | £25,000 | £30,000 |
| 3 years | £21,000 | £26,500 | £33,000 |
| 5 years | £23,500 | £30,500 | £34,000 |
UK subject average: £27,000 — sector benchmark across all UK universities
Salary trend: ↑ up £4,000 from year 3 to year 5
Salary figures are sourced from Discover Uni graduate outcomes data for this subject area at this provider (subject area: CAH15-01). These represent typical earnings and may not reflect this specific course. For official data, visit Discover Uni at Discover Uni.
